Requirements

  • Successful completion of the Civil Engineer Trainee training program (Commonwealth job title or equivalent Federal Government job title, as determined by the Office of Administration)
  • Five years of civil engineering experience in the appropriate specialty, and an Engineer-in-Training certificate issued by or acceptable to the Pennsylvania State Registration Board for Professional Engineers, Land Surveyors and Geologists
  • Four years of civil engineering experience in the appropriate specialty, and an engineer-in-training certificate issued by or acceptable to the Pennsylvania State Registration Board for Professional Engineers, Land Surveyors and Geologists, and an associate’s degree in civil engineering technology or a closely related engineering discipline
  • One year of civil engineering experience in the appropriate specialty, and a bachelor’s degree in civil engineering or a closely related engineering discipline
  • Possession of a valid driver’s license

Responsibilities

  • Evaluate plans, studies, designs, and permits for compliance with standards and policies
  • Conduct traffic studies, operational reviews, and field investigations using engineering tools
  • Assist with maintenance and management of databases, inventories, and operational programs
  • Communicate with municipalities, consultants, contractors, and internal units on project needs
  • Investigate inquiries and provide technical guidance on transportation and safety concerns
  • Participate in training and support knowledge sharing for staff and trainees
